Navigation has always been part of the system. It NEVER went away. The blue arrow icon was only an extension of Google maps. It was also in beta phase this whole time. MAPS has always been the core navigation application.

There just is no longer a Navigation icon. Just use Google maps. My favorite way of doing it is using Google Now. Just say "navigate to (insert address or name of place here)." It works like a charm!

I don't think this works after the 4.3 update, because the new version becomes the base maps app. There's no 'updated' version to uninstall.

I'm not sure what you mean by "Google Navigation no longer has the Maps function." If you meant the opposite (Maps no longer has navigation) that's not correct. Navigation is accessed from inside the maps app.
